The Stolen Sun

Summary

Sindri Suncatcher is back in this thrilling conclusion to the Suncatcher Trilogy! Sindri has defeated the evil wizard Anica, but the conflict is far from over. Old foes endanger Sindri's home village in Kendermore, while old friends add confusion to an already frenzied situation. And in the midst of all the chaos, Sindri must make the hardest choice of his life. Jeff Sampson's final book in the Suncatcher Trilogy shows the power of friendship - and learning which friends you can trust.

The Ebony Eye

Summary

Everyone knows that kender can’t do magic. But Sindri Suncatcher - the greatest kender wizard in the world - can. Now that Sindri knows who has been trying to kill him, he sets out on a mission to find out why. But the friends who accompany him have confusing motivations. The black robed wizard Maddoc has lied to Sindri one too many times. And the renegade hunter who once vowed to imprison Sindri now acts like a true friend. As Sindri and his friends break into a mechanical maze guarded by a frightening gorgon, the kender apprentice must tackle a grave lesson: how not to trust.

The Wayward Wizard

Summary

Everyone knows kender can’t do magic. But Sindri Suncatcher - the greatest kender wizard in the world - can. Back at Cairngorn Keep, the black-robed wizard Maddoc has made Sindri his apprentice. But a mysterious stranger interrupts Sindri’s training, and soon Sindri finds himself chased by strange monsters and receiving cryptic messages. Will these extraordinary events lead to Sindri’s destiny - or his doom?

Wizard's Betrayal

Summary

The Trinistyr: Ancient holy relic. Cursed symbol of power. Key to Nearra’s future...or her destruction. An antique map reveals yet another family secret: Nearra must relive the suffering of two more of the wizards betrayed by her ancestor, or her family’s magic and the healing power of the Trinistyr will never be restored. Undeterred, Nearra, Jirah, and their friends continue their mission, arriving at the once great city of Tarsis. But they do not journey alone. Two elf mages watch them from afar, while a dark cleric follows their every move. Betrayals come to light. New powers arise. And a startling revelation threatens to destroy Nearra, once and for all.
